'06 SL500 COMAND or Battery Problem?

Lately when starting up my '06 SL500, the COMAND does not power up and "please wait" appears in the right multifunction display window. After 3-5 minutes, the display changes to "----", and I see the COMAND screen changing appearance as if it were booting up. After another 3-4 minutes, the right display changes to "off" and the COMAND is now ready for use. I had the the consumer battery tested and the report was all OK. The total inop time period varies from a high of around 8 minutes to fully power up to a low of 5 seconds; more often it's around 3-5 minutes, but the sequence of messages in the display window is always the same whenever starting up my SL. What do these symptoms tell you? Thanks
